The Diaper Bank of North Carolina is located in Durham, NC. It is sort of like a food bank in a…read moresense but instead of food they partner with 18 agencies to provide diapers; feminine products and incontinence products to those with a need for them. They want each family to have access to basic necessities for better health; dignity and quality of life. Since 2013, they have distributed over 15 million diapers. I volunteered for a two hour shift at the diaper bank. You are in a warehouse that is not climate control but there are fans. We were provided instructions how to repackage the diapers and rewrap the new bundles in plastic wrap. In that 2 hour time frame, everyone there repackaged 19,500 diapers so that was impressive. If you are looking for an agency to volunteer or donate this one serves a good purpose.

Most of us do not spend a lot of time thinking about diapers. But if you are a parent, grandparent,…read moreor caregiver without enough of them, they can become a major source of stress, guilt, and desperation. Public safety net programs such as The Special Supplemental Nutrition Program for Women, Infants, and Children (WIC) and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P, previously known as Food Stamps) do not cover the purchase of diapers, often leaving families with a difficult decision between buying diapers and other necessities with their limited funds. For families in need, something as small as a diaper can have a significant impact.
